FPGA は本質的に、プログラマブル ロジック ブロックと、構成情報をロードすることで特定の機能を実行するようにプログラムされた構成可能な相互接続を含むハードウェアです。ソフトウェアとは異なり、FPGA の構成はプログラミング中にのみ変更でき、ロジックはハードウェアで実行されるため、ソフトウェアよりも桁違いに高速です。
FPGAはハードウェアですか、それともソフトウェアですか?
FPGA (Field Programmable Gate Array) は本質的にはハードウェアです。
説明を展開:
FPGA は、プログラマブル ロジック ブロックと構成可能な相互接続を含む半導体デバイスです。論理ブロックは論理演算と算術演算を実行でき、相互接続はこれらのブロック間の接続として機能します。構成情報を FPGA にロードすることで、特定の機能を実行するようにプログラムできます。
FPGA は、次の点でソフトウェアとは異なります。
一方、FPGA にはハードウェアとの類似点もあります:
つまり、FPGA はいくつかの側面 (プログラマビリティなど) ではソフトウェアのように動作できますが、それでも本質的にはハードウェア コンポーネントです。
以上がFPGA はハードウェアですか、それともソフトウェアです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。